Ron Johnson is a Republican senator from Wisconsin who has served since 2011 and currently chairs the Permanent Subcommittee on Investigations, a powerful oversight body within the Senate Committee on Homeland Security and Governmental Affairs. As chair, he controls which investigations the subcommittee pursues and shapes its agenda on federal accountability matters. He also chairs the Fiscal Responsibility and Economic Growth subcommittee and serves on several other committees including Budget, Finance, and Aging.
Johnson's background as a businessman gives him a particular focus on fiscal and regulatory matters. He co-founded and led Pacur, a plastics manufacturer in Oshkosh, Wisconsin, for decades before entering politics in 2010. His entry into electoral politics was motivated by opposition to the Affordable Care Act, and he has maintained a consistent focus on government spending, balanced budgets, and regulatory reform throughout his Senate career.
As chair of the Permanent Subcommittee on Investigations during his second term, Johnson launched high-profile investigations into Hillary Clinton, Hunter Biden, and officials involved in the FBI investigation of the Trump campaign. He was a major witness in the 2019 Trump-Ukraine scandal due to his interactions with Ukrainian officials. In his current term, he has focused investigations on what he characterizes as corruption in federal agencies.
Johnson has built a legislative profile centered on fiscal conservatism, skepticism of government institutions, and alignment with the Trump administration. He has sponsored numerous bills addressing government shutdowns, regulatory reform, and trade policy. His political positions include opposition to climate science consensus, support for alternative medicine, and calls for stricter immigration enforcement. He has also promoted various conspiracy theories throughout his tenure, ranging from election-related claims to vaccine skepticism.
